Overview
OD Link is a web-based electronic medical records and practice management system for optometry clinics. It centralizes patient charts and routine administrative tasks for optical practices.
Typical capabilities include digital charting, appointment scheduling, and tools for managing dispensing and billing workflows. The platform fits single-site optometry practices and small teams that need an integrated front- and back-office workflow.
It may not be ideal for larger multispecialty groups or practices requiring extensive customization or enterprise reporting. Evaluate customization, interoperability, and support to determine whether it meets more complex operational needs.
